A review is presented of the materials used to control or eliminate foam in industrial processes and how they function. These materials are classified by their chemical type. Main active liquid-phase components are hydrocarbon oils, polyethers, and silicone fluids; main solid-phase components are waxy hydrocarbons … flipped across x axis https://charltonteam.com

WebFor the alleviation of flatulence, an antifoaming agent such as simethicone may be taken orally. This agent will coalesce the smaller gas bubbles into larger bubbles, thereby easing the release of gas within the gastrointestinal tract via burping or flatulence. Classification Antifoaming agents
